Tex-Mex cuisine is actually a delightful fusion of Texan and Mexican culinary traditions, born when Mexican immigrants adapted their recipes to American ingredients within the early twentieth century.

However enchiladas are actually a fixture in American household kitchens and Tex Mex cuisine, they may have their roots in Mexico. Styles of enchiladas range enormously from location to location and from kitchen area to kitchen area, but commonly, they encompass tortillas dipped in a very sauce after which rolled all around a filling.
